浙江科技大学:《可编程器件EDA技术与实践》课程教学课件(讲稿)第3章 Quartus II开发软件应用

第三章QuartusⅡI开发软件应用包括基于模块的设计输入设计、系统级设计和软件开发(Design Entry)功耗分析综合(PowerAnalysis((Synthesis)布局布线调试(Place&Route)(Debugging)工程更改管理时序分析CEngineeringChange(TimingAnalysis)Management)时序逼近仿真(TimingClosure)(Simulation)绵程和配置CProgramming&Configuration
第三章 Quartus II 开发软件应用

Quartusll软件版本最新为11.0,虽然软件的核心构架万变不离其宗,但可以看到Altera一直在努力,致力于更完美的用户界面,更快的综合速度的软件开发。(1)Quartusll9.1之前的软件自带仿真组件和硬件库而之后软件不再包含,因此必须选择安装仿真组件Modelsim和硬件库。(2)Quartus ll 11.0之前的软件需要额外下载Nios Il组件,而11.0开始Quartus ll 软件自带Nios ll 组件。(3)Quartus ll 10.1之前软件包括时钟综合器,即Settings中包含TimeQuest Timing Analyzer,以及Classic Timing Analyzer,但10.1以后的版本只包含了TimeQuset Time Analyzer,因此需要sdc来约束时序
Quartus II软件版本最新为11.0,虽然软件的核心构架 万变不离其宗,但可以看到Altera一直在努力,致力 于更完美的用户界面,更快的综合速度的软件开发。 (1)Quartus II 9.1之前的软件自带仿真组件和硬件库 ,而之后软件不再包含,因此必须选择安装仿真组 件Modelsim和硬件库。 (2)Quartus II 11.0之前的软件需要额外下载Nios II 组件,而11.0开始Quartus II 软件自带Nios II 组件。 (3)Quartus II 10.1之前软件包括时钟综合器,即 Settings中包含TimeQuest Timing Analyzer,以及 Classic Timing Analyzer,但10.1以后的版本只包含 了TimeQuset Time Analyzer,因此需要sdc来约束时 序

软件下载方法:(1)可以去官网下载最新软件,地址为http://www.altera.com.cn/b/fpga-design-with-quartus-ii.html?f=hp&k=pb2-0可以根据需要下载网络免费版,或者订购版(破解版)(2)可以在alteraftp用迅雷下载(支持断点续传),地址为:ftp://ftp.altera.com/outgoing/release/在列表中选择以下组件下载(针对XP系统而言):a. 11.0 quartus windows.exe :Quartus ll 软件b. 11.0 devices windows.exe :Quartus ll 硬件库c. 11.0 modelsim ase windows.exe :Altera Modelsim 仿真软件另外还需下载Quartus l 6.111.0版本软件的crack具体安装步骤自行上网查询
软件下载方法: (1)可以去官网下载最新软件,地址为 http://www.altera.com.cn/b/fpga-design-with-quartusii.html?f=hp&k=pb2-0, 可以根据需要下载网络免费版,或者订购版(破解版)。 (2)可以在altera ftp用迅雷下载(支持断点续传),地 址为: ftp://ftp.altera.com/outgoing/release/ 在列表中选择以下组件下载(针对xp系统而言): a. 11.0_quartus_windows.exe :Quartus II 软件 b. 11.0_devices_windows.exe :Quartus II 硬件库 c. 11.0_modelsim_ase_windows.exe :Altera Modelsim 仿 真软件 另外还需下载Quartus II 6.1~11.0版本软件的crack 具体安装步骤自行上网查询

(License.dat)安装后第一次启动软件需要获取许可文件Quartus IlFileEditToolsViewProjectProcessingYindowHelpAssiermentsEDASimulation ToolA?昆T二X定OOTHERun EDA TimingAnalysis ToolStatusXLaunch DesignSpace ExplorerModuleProg...2Advanced List PathsTimeQuest Timing AnalyzerAdvisors&Chip EditorHetlist Viewers SignalTap II Logic AnalyzerAIn-SystemMemoryContentEditorLogie Analyzer Interface EditorSignalProbe Pins..ProgrammerJAJMegaizardPlug-InManager.SOPC Builder..Tel Seripts.*Customize...Options.License Setup
安装后第一次启动软件需要获取许可文件(License.dat)

OptionsCategory:License SetupLicense SetupProcessingGlobal User Libraries (All ProjeE:quartus6winlicense.datLicense file:-AssignmentEditorColorsUseLM LICENSE FILE yariableFontsCurrentLicense白-Block/SymbolEditorWebLicenseUpdateColorsLicense Type:Full VersionFontsSubscriptionExpiration:22020.12Begin 3o-dayGracePerioc白ChipEditorNICIDHost ID Type:ColorsHost IDValue:00225f346accFontsLogicLockRegionswindow-MemoryEditorLicensedAMPP/MegaCorefunctions:LFontsVendorProductMessages0000D'Crypt Pte.Ltd. [0100]Suppression0000D'Crypt Pte. Ltd. (0101)Colors0000KCN(049B]KCN (049C)0000Fonts0000Omniwerks[0890]PinPlanner0000Omniwerks [0891].Programmer0000MorethanlP(106D)-ReportWindow0000MorethanlP(106E]. ColorsAlcatel (11DC)0000Fonts0000Alcatel [11DD]annnR白-ResourcePropertyEdito>Colors-RTL/TechnologyMapViewerLocalSysteminfo在License Setup窗口中正确指向许可文件地址
在License Setup窗口中正确指向许可文件地址

项目名称XQartue II-[adderzyzl.v]菜单栏boFile可XEditViewProjectToolsWindowHelpAssignmentsProcessingD?CCProject Navigatorxbeadderzyz1.v快捷工具4Entitymoduleadderzyzi(cout,sum,a,b,cin):人ACompilation Hierarchy2input[2:0] a,b;T3input cin;项目窗口9output cout;丰5output[2:0]sum;6assign(cout,sum)=a+b+cin;encmodule8HierarchyFiles DesignUnits福KStatusAx主窗口ModuleProg.%Time昌国状态窗口S2286abVVx1信息窗口SystemProcessingAExtraInfo AInfo AWarning ACriticalWarningErrorASuppressedMessage:LocateLocalion0For Help, press F1Ln8,Col1国照IdleQuatus Il 软件界面
Quatus II 软件界面

创建工程文件1)新建工程:File菜单下NewProjectWizard建立新工程。建立新工程时,指定工程工作目录分配工程名称,指定顶层设计实体的名称。还可以指定在工程中实用的设计文件、其他源文件、用户库和EDA工具,以及目标器件(或者让Quartusll软件自动选择器件)。工程命名或路径中只能由英文字母、数字和下划线组成,且只能以英文字母作开头,绝不能出现任何汉字形式提醒顶层文件名与工程名是一致的;器件选择要与自己的开发板一致;(EPM24OT100C5N)建立工程后可以用“Assignment”菜单下的“Settings”修改工程设置,在工程中添加和删除设计和其他文件
创建工程文件 1)新建工程:File 菜单下New Project Wizard建 立新工程。建立新工程时,指定工程工作目录, 分配工程名称,指定顶层设计实体的名称。还 可以指定在工程中实用的设计文件、其他源文 件、用户库和EDA工具,以及目标器件(或者让 Quartus II 软件自动选择器件)。 提醒 工程命名或路径中只能由英文字母、数字和下划线组成, 且只能以英文字母作开头,绝不能出现任何汉字形式。 顶层文件名与工程名是一致的; 器件选择要与自己的开发板一致;(EPM240T100C5N) 建立工程后可以用“Assignment”菜单下的“Settings” 修改 工程设置,在工程中添加和删除设计和其他文件

创建工程文件2)建立设计文件:使用BlockEditor以原理图和框图的形式输入和编辑图形设计信息(.bdf)使用TextEditor输入或编辑AHDL(.tdf)、VHDL(.vhd)和 Verilog HDL(.v) 等语言的文本型设计 ;使用Symbol Editor 用于查看和编辑代表宏功能、宏功能模块、基本单元或设计文件的预定义符号(.sym)使用Altera宏功能模块LPM(LibraryofParameterizedModules)构建复杂的高级模块,必须使用宏功能模块才可以使用一些Altera专用器件的功能,例如,存储器、DSP 块、LVDS 驱动器
创建工程文件 2)建立设计文件: 使用Block Editor以原理图和框图的形式输入和编辑 图形设计信息(.bdf) ; 使用Text Editor输入或编辑AHDL(.tdf)、VHDL (.vhd)和 Verilog HDL(.v) 等语言的文本型设计; 使用Symbol Editor 用于查看和编辑代表宏功能、宏 功能模块、基本单元或设计文件的预定义符号 ( .sym) 使用Altera 宏功能模块LPM(Library of Parameterized Modules)构建复杂的高级模块 ,必须使用宏功能 模块才可以使用一些 Altera 专用器件的功能,例如 ,存储器、DSP 块、LVDS 驱动器

>原理图输入:菜单“File"/"New",在弹出的新建设计文件类型对话框中选择“BlockDiagram/SchematicFile"。>在原理图编辑界面,菜单“Edit"/"lnsertSymbol"选择Libraries下某个库中的元件符号,然后连线,构造所需的电路系统。还可以在工作窗口选绘图按钮,或按右键选D'lnsert/Symbol>Megafunction:宏功能库,其中的元件需要定义参数;>Primitives:基本图元库,提供基本逻辑元件符号>Others/Maxplus ll:有常用通用器件如计数器等
原理图输入:菜单“File”/“New” ,在弹出的新建 设计文件类型对话框中选择“Block Diagram/Schematic File” 。 在原理图编辑界面,菜单“Edit” /“Insert Symbol” , 选择Libraries下某个库中的元件符号,然后连线, 构造所需的电路系统。还可以在工作窗口选绘图 按钮 ,或按右键选择”Insert /Symbol” Megafunction:宏功能库,其中的元件需要定义 参数; Primitives:基本图元库,提供基本逻辑元件符 号 Others/Maxplus II:有常用通用器件如计数器等

1SW1SW2OUTPUTLOUTPUT脑NOSW3三人表决器SW1、SW2、SW3为表决开关,同意为“1”,不同意为“0”L2为“1”表示通过,L1为“1”表示否决
按次数下载不扣除下载券;
注册用户24小时内重复下载只扣除一次;
顺序:VIP每日次数-->可用次数-->下载券;
- 浙江科技大学:《可编程器件EDA技术与实践》课程教学课件(讲稿)第2章 可编程逻辑器件的结构与工作原理 2.5 在系统可编程技术和ispLSI逻辑器件.pdf
- 浙江科技大学:《可编程器件EDA技术与实践》课程教学课件(讲稿)第2章 可编程逻辑器件的结构与工作原理 2.4 现场可编程门阵列FPGA.pdf
- 浙江科技大学:《可编程器件EDA技术与实践》课程教学课件(讲稿)第2章 可编程逻辑器件的结构与工作原理 2.3 阵列型高密度可编程逻辑器件CPLD.pdf
- 浙江科技大学:《可编程器件EDA技术与实践》课程教学课件(讲稿)第2章 可编程逻辑器件的结构与工作原理 2.2 低密度逻辑器件.pdf
- 浙江科技大学:《可编程器件EDA技术与实践》课程教学课件(讲稿)第2章 可编程逻辑器件的结构与工作原理 2.1 可编程逻辑器件基础.pdf
- 浙江科技大学:《可编程器件EDA技术与实践》课程教学课件(讲稿)第1章 EDA技术概述(主讲:郑玉珍).pdf
- 浙江科技大学:《嵌入式系统》课程教学大纲(Embedded System B,EDA).pdf
- 福建工程学院:《电路》课程教学课件(讲稿)第14章 非线性电路.pdf
- 福建工程学院:《电路》课程教学课件(讲稿)第13章 电路方程的矩阵形式.pdf
- 福建工程学院:《电路》课程教学课件(讲稿)第12章 二端口网络.pdf
- 福建工程学院:《电路》课程教学课件(讲稿)第11章 线性动态电路的复频域分析.pdf
- 福建工程学院:《电路》课程教学课件(讲稿)第10章 线性动态电路的时域分析.pdf
- 福建工程学院:《电路》课程教学课件(讲稿)第9章 非正弦周期电路的稳态分析.pdf
- 福建工程学院:《电路》课程教学课件(讲稿)第8章 三相电路.pdf
- 福建工程学院:《电路》课程教学课件(讲稿)第7章 电路的频率响应.pdf
- 福建工程学院:《电路》课程教学课件(讲稿)第6章 耦合电感电路的分析.pdf
- 福建工程学院:《电路》课程教学课件(讲稿)第5章 正弦稳态电路的分析.pdf
- 福建工程学院:《电路》课程教学课件(讲稿)第4章 电路的分析计算法(电路定理法).pdf
- 福建工程学院:《电路》课程教学课件(讲稿)第3章 电路的分析计算法(电路方程法).pdf
- 福建工程学院:《电路》课程教学课件(讲稿)第2章 电路的分析计算法(等效变换法).pdf
- 浙江科技大学:《可编程器件EDA技术与实践》课程教学课件(讲稿)第4章 HDL语言入门.pdf
- 浙江科技大学:《可编程器件EDA技术与实践》课程教学课件(讲稿)第5章 EDA技术与应用项目实践.pdf
- 《机电传动控制》课程教学大纲 Electromechanical transmission and control A(2007).pdf
- 《机电传动控制》课程授课教案(授课教师:高俊).pdf
- 《机电传动控制》课程教学课件(讲稿)第2章 机电传动的动力学基础.pdf
- 《机电传动控制》课程教学课件(讲稿)第1章 机电传动控制概述.pdf
- 《机电传动控制》课程教学课件(讲稿)第5章 交流电动机的工作原理(5.1-5.4,5.7-5.8).pdf
- 《机电传动控制》课程教学课件(讲稿)第3章 直流电机的工作原理.pdf
- 《机电传动控制》课程教学课件(讲稿)第5章 交流电动机的工作原理(5.5 三相异步电动机的调速特性、5.6 三相异步电动机的制动特性).pdf
- 《机电传动控制》课程教学课件(讲稿)第13章 步进电动机传动控制系统.pdf
- 《机电传动控制》课程教学课件(讲稿)第6章 控制电机.pdf
- 《机电传动控制》课程教学课件(讲稿)第8章 继电器-接触器控制系统.pdf
- 北京交通大学:《自动控制理论》课程教学课件(讲稿)第一章 自动控制的一般概念(主讲:邱瑞昌).pdf
- 北京理工大学:《控制理论基础》课程教学资源(实验教程,基于MATLAB语言).pdf
- 《电工技术》课程教学资源(PPT课件)第6讲 复阻抗电路、正弦交流电路功率因数.pptx
- 《电工技术》课程教学资源(PPT课件)第10讲 电路基础(一阶暂态电路三要素法).pptx
- 《电工技术》课程教学资源(PPT课件)第4讲 戴维南定律、正弦交流电概念.pptx
- 《电工技术》课程教学资源(PPT课件)第11-12讲 变压器.pptx
- 《电工技术》课程教学资源(PPT课件)第8讲 三相交流电路、电路暂态过程.pptx
- 《电工技术》课程教学资源(PPT课件)第5讲 单一参数交流电路、RLC串联交流电路.pptx
